Family Violence and Domestic Assault

Allegations of domestic assault and family violence can be severe. Not only do they jeopardize your parental rights, they also carry with them the possibility of jail time and a heavy fine. In Texas, the state will charge you with a felony for your second domestic violence charge. While it may be possible to plea bargain with prosecutors in other counties, it is unlikely to occur in Dallas County. When the police are called for an alleged assault, they will usually arrest anyone they suspect is involved. Assaults can range from simple bar fights to aggravated assaults. There can be severe collateral consequences from an assault case with a finding of family violence. You could potentially be barred from ever owning a firearm, even for hunting purposes. If you are not a U.S. citizen, an assault case may lead to deportation or denial of citizenship. Further, many of these cases result in protective or stay away orders that keep you from being with family members.
